I Heart Absinthe Salary

As of August 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at I Heart Absinthe in the United States is $44.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$90,934. Salaries at I Heart Absinthe typically range from $38 to $50 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About I Heart Absinthe
I Heart Absinthe is the #1 website in the United States for all things relating to absinthe. We are also the largest website for absinthe ware on the Internet, featuring both antique and reprodtion pieces used to drink absinthe. What Is the Cost of Living Near Baton Rouge?

Understanding the cost of living near Baton Rouge is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at I Heart Absinthe.
Baton Rouge's Cost of Living Index is approximately 90.3 (9.7% less expensive than US average; 2.9% less than LA average). State capital (LSU), affordable housing. CATS b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from I Heart Absinthe,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$900 - $1,400+ A significant portion of I Heart Absinthe sal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$56 (CATS 31-day p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$390 - $570 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$670+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,206 - $3,546+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
